The KeSPA Cup match played on 2026-07-20 between Kiwoom DRX and HANJIN BRION ended with a win for Kiwoom DRX. The two teams combined for 42 kills, so this was a fight-heavy game. Over 34:23 of play, that many kills means the KDA below reflects teamfight participation more than lane advantage. The total gold gap was only 1,018, so resources alone did not decide this game. Kiwoom DRX finished narrowly ahead, and in games like this a single objective or a single fight is usually what settles it. The clearest objective gap came from Towers: 8 for Kiwoom DRX against 3 for the other side.

A KDA of 14/1/4 is what Ucal recorded on Locke, the strongest line among the winners. Comparing end-of-game gold position by position, the widest gap sits at Mid: Ucal ahead of Roamer by 3,543. The draft started with Kiwoom DRX removing Poppy and HANJIN BRION removing Nocturne. Those first two cards set the direction of the draft. This match was played on patch 16.14.
